Hello folks and welcome to a small MOC I made for the 40th birthday of my brother-in-law. (This was also the first time I have given away a MOC ) He's the owner of a fuel station in my home town and he also drives one of the tanker trucks to deliver oil to private houses. I started breaking up set 3180 (tank truck) to see what I could use for inspiration. Within a short time I realized that there weren't too many bricks useable for it, except for the front and the base. Then I started building the new truck with blue bricks where I didn't have the right parts at hand, followed by 3 BL orders. Some details here and there and I was finished with the build. The red tile was by far the most difficult part to add to the sides. I didn't want to stay where I placed it. First I tried flexible hoses and clips (see photo above), but that didn't work. I ended up in using... can you see it? But what is a truck without advertising? So I made some nice decals and I have to say I'm very pleased with the final model! Now what does the real thing look like? The complete BS-folder. Thanks for watching and commenting.

I was aware of this screw issue when I put my cargo train together. Although I didn't have any problems in opening it I don't think it was a good idea not to use just clickable locks. Metal screws and soft plastic - it is just a matter of time when the plasctic will loosen and not hold the screw any more. My problem solver: I ordered two more Li-Po-boxes.
